Dr. Beth Ann Scruggs is a seasoned professional with a diverse background in grant development, education, and nonprofit management. Currently serving as a Grant Specialist for the City of Rock Hill, SC, Dr. Scruggs excels in identifying grant opportunities and managing awards that align with organizational goals. Previously, Dr. Scruggs was the RENEW Center Director at Adult Enrichment Centers, overseeing a Montessori Dementia Day program. Experience in higher education includes roles as Director of Resource Development and Administration, Advancement Services Coordinator, and Adjunct Faculty at York Technical College, focusing on student success and curriculum development. Additional roles include Development Associate at Hospice & Community Care and Prospect Research Manager at Lycoming College. Dr. Scruggs holds a Doctor of Education degree in Curriculum and Instruction from the University of South Carolina, a Master’s in Higher Education Administration from Bay Path University, and a Bachelor of Arts from Lycoming College.

Rock Hill, South Carolina is a business-savvy blend of historic charm and responsibly implemented expansion. The city is located in the north-central area of South Carolina approximately 20 miles south of Charlotte, NC along the I-77 corridor. Rock Hill is a growing community of nearly 70,000 residents, and the City encompasses over 36 square miles. Rock Hill is the largest city in York County, SC and the only major South Carolina city in the Charlotte area.
